Titan America, LLC, is a leading environmentally and socially progressive heavy building materials company located in the eastern United States. Titan America is part of the TITAN Group, an independent, multi-regional producer of cement and other related building materials. Our products include cement, aggregate, ready-mixed concrete and fly ash beneficiation. TITAN Group has a record of continuous growth since its establishment in 1902. It has expanded its production and distribution operations into 13 countries, employing more than 5,500 people. Job Description:

Titan Virginia Ready Mix is looking for high energy women and men to fill an opening for a Safety Training Specialist in our Sterling, VA facility.  Titan Virginia Ready Mix offers excellent wages and benefits, including health, dental, vision, 401k savings plan, paid vacation, and holidays.  Candidates should be flexible, patient, trustworthy, customer service driven, and adaptable to changing environments and schedules.

 

This salaried, non-exempt position, will build and continue revitalization of a World-Class Safety culture within Titan Virginia Ready Mix.  The Safety Training Specialist is responsible for training and compliance with policies and procedures governing safe working conditions within our industry.  Furthermore, incumbent will create a culture that fully supports fast-changing high-performance environment. Visible leadership promoting the zero incident culture will be a significant key to success.  The job duties described herein are not exhaustive and may be supplemented.

Responsibilities

Responsibilities:

  • Drive a Safety culture and lead the charge for change through action
  • Conduct New Hire Safety Orientations
  • Conduct Monthly Safety Meetings with all on-site employees
  • Provide refresher training for all employees
  • Conduct Smith System Training
  • Conduct Ready Mix Driving Simulator Training
  • Assist the Safety Manager in conducting incident investigations and root cause analysis when incidents occur and ensure corrective actions are put in place to prevent recurrence
  • Provide visible presence in the field to perform observations and inspections to support the Driver Trainers
  • Identify best practices that can be duplicated, implemented, and measured with metrics clear and consistent performance
  • Establish trust/credibility with business leaders at all locations
  • Travel to our different locations within the northern Virginia region
